Dynamic

Custom Engine Development vs Engine Selection

Developers should learn Custom Engine Development when working on projects requiring high performance, unique features, or full control over the technology stack, such as AAA video games, real-time simulations, or niche applications with specific hardware integration meets developers should learn engine selection to make informed decisions when starting new projects, ensuring they pick an engine that aligns with project goals, team expertise, and budget constraints. Here's our take.

🧊Nice Pick

Custom Engine Development

Developers should learn Custom Engine Development when working on projects requiring high performance, unique features, or full control over the technology stack, such as AAA video games, real-time simulations, or niche applications with specific hardware integration

Custom Engine Development

Nice Pick

Developers should learn Custom Engine Development when working on projects requiring high performance, unique features, or full control over the technology stack, such as AAA video games, real-time simulations, or niche applications with specific hardware integration

Pros

  • +It is essential for optimizing resource usage, implementing custom algorithms, and avoiding licensing restrictions or limitations of commercial engines
  • +Related to: c-plus-plus, computer-graphics

Cons

  • -Specific tradeoffs depend on your use case

Engine Selection

Developers should learn engine selection to make informed decisions when starting new projects, ensuring they pick an engine that aligns with project goals, team expertise, and budget constraints

Pros

  • +It's crucial for game developers, VR/AR creators, and simulation engineers to avoid costly mid-project switches and optimize development efficiency
  • +Related to: game-development, project-planning

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

Use Custom Engine Development if: You want it is essential for optimizing resource usage, implementing custom algorithms, and avoiding licensing restrictions or limitations of commercial engines and can live with specific tradeoffs depend on your use case.

Use Engine Selection if: You prioritize it's crucial for game developers, vr/ar creators, and simulation engineers to avoid costly mid-project switches and optimize development efficiency over what Custom Engine Development offers.

🧊
The Bottom Line
Custom Engine Development wins

Developers should learn Custom Engine Development when working on projects requiring high performance, unique features, or full control over the technology stack, such as AAA video games, real-time simulations, or niche applications with specific hardware integration

Disagree with our pick? nice@nicepick.dev